Upcoming Events

Age Group
Age Group
Program Type
Registration Type

Primary tabs

This event is in the "Middle School" group
This event is in the "High School" group

Tween & Teen Book Bag Registration: SUMMER 2026

All Day 4/13–5/11
Middle School, High School
At Home (Supplies and/or written instructions provided), Reading Programs
Library Branch: Villa Park Public Library
Age Group: Middle School, High School
Program Type: At Home (Supplies and/or written instructions provided), Reading Programs
Event Details:

For students in Grades 4 - 12.

This event is in the "Adults" group
This event is in the "Seniors" group

Take & Make Craft

04/19/2026 @ 12:45pm–04/25/2026 @ 5:00pm
Adults, Seniors
Take & Make
Library Branch: Villa Park Public Library
Age Group: Adults, Seniors
Program Type: Take & Make
Event Details:

Come to the second floor Information desk to come pick up a kit to take home the supplies to make a sunflower wreath!

While supplies last, 1 per person.

This event is in the "Everyone" group

Spice Club - Marjoram

04/19/2026 @ 1:00pm–04/25/2026 @ 5:00pm
Everyone
Cooking
Closed
Registration Required
Library Branch: Villa Park Public Library
Age Group: Everyone
Program Type: Cooking
Registration Required
Event Details:

Once you have signed up, stop by the library on the dates listed below to pick up your spice kit. Take the kit home, test out the recipe and let us know how it worked for you!

This event is in the "Adults" group
This event is in the "Seniors" group

Movie Pack Subscription

04/20/2026 @ 9:30am–05/01/2026 @ 5:00pm
Adults, Seniors
At Home (Supplies and/or written instructions provided), Movies
Upcoming
Registration Required
Library Branch: Villa Park Public Library
Age Group: Adults, Seniors
Program Type: At Home (Supplies and/or written instructions provided), Movies
Registration Required
Event Details:

Pick-up Dates: Tuesdays, May. 12, 26; June. 9, 23; July. 7, 21; August. 4, 18 

This event is in the "Youth" group
This event is in the "Babies" group
This event is in the "Toddlers" group
This event is in the "Preschool" group

Rhythm and Rhyme Community Storytime - Villa Park Recreation Center

10:00am–10:30am
Youth, Babies, Toddlers, Preschool
Outreach Programs, Outside Organizations, Storytimes
Offsite Event
Library Branch: Off Site
Age Group: Youth, Babies, Toddlers, Preschool
Program Type: Outreach Programs, Outside Organizations, Storytimes
Event Details:

Join us on the road for a special story time featuring themed picture books, movement, and other activities! Children of all ages are welcome with an adult present. Registration is not required.

This event is in the "Youth" group
This event is in the "Toddlers" group

Toddler Time - Mondays 10:30am

10:30am–11:00am
Youth, Toddlers
Storytimes
Waitlist
Registration Required
Library Branch: Villa Park Public Library
Room: Jelf Room (Youth Services Program Room)
Age Group: Youth, Toddlers
Program Type: Storytimes
Registration Required
Event Details:

Sign up for ONE weekly session time:

  • Mondays 10:30-11am -OR-
  • Mondays 11:30am-12pm -OR-
  • Thursdays 10:30-11am -OR-
  • Thur
This event is in the "Adults" group
This event is in the "Seniors" group

Adult Book Bag Subscription Registration

04/20/2026 @ 10:30am–04/27/2026 @ 11:30pm
Adults, Seniors
Reading Programs, Take & Make
Upcoming
Registration Required
Library Branch: Villa Park Public Library
Age Group: Adults, Seniors
Program Type: Reading Programs, Take & Make
Registration Required
Event Details:

Pick-up Dates: Fridays, May 8; Jun. 5; Jul. 3; Aug. 7

This event is in the "Youth" group
This event is in the "Babies" group
This event is in the "Toddlers" group
This event is in the "Preschool" group

Rhythm & Rhyme Community Storytime- Oakbrook Terrace Heritage Center

11:30am–12:00pm
Youth, Babies, Toddlers, Preschool
Outreach Programs, Outside Organizations, Storytimes
Offsite Event
Library Branch: Off Site
Age Group: Youth, Babies, Toddlers, Preschool
Program Type: Outreach Programs, Outside Organizations, Storytimes
Event Details:

Join us on the road for a special story time featuring themed picture books, movement, and other activities! Children of all ages are welcome with an adult present. Registration is not required.

This event is in the "Youth" group
This event is in the "Toddlers" group

Toddler Time - Mondays 11:30am

11:30am–12:00pm
Youth, Toddlers
Storytimes
Waitlist
Registration Required
Library Branch: Villa Park Public Library
Room: Jelf Room (Youth Services Program Room)
Age Group: Youth, Toddlers
Program Type: Storytimes
Registration Required
Event Details:

Sign up for ONE weekly session time:

  • Mondays 10:30-11am -OR-
  • Mondays 11:30am-12pm -OR-
  • Thursdays 10:30-11am -OR-
  • Thur
This event is in the "Adults" group
This event is in the "Seniors" group

Movie Matinee: Desk Set

1:00pm–3:00pm
Adults, Seniors
Movies
Library Branch: Villa Park Public Library
Room: Ohrman Room A/B
Age Group: Adults, Seniors
Program Type: Movies
Event Details:

Desk Set (© Twentieth Century Fox, 1957: TV-G, 103 min.) 

This event is in the "Adults" group
This event is in the "Seniors" group

Great Decisions 2026

7:00pm–8:30pm
Adults, Seniors
Book Discussions
Open
Registration Required
Library Branch: Villa Park Public Library
Room: Ohrman Room A/B
Age Group: Adults, Seniors
Program Type: Book Discussions
Registration Required
Event Details:

Great Decisions is America's largest discussion program on world affairs.  This program series highlights eight critical foreign policy challenges facing Americans each year.

This event is in the "Youth" group
This event is in the "Babies" group

Babies & Books - Tuesdays

9:30am–10:00am
Youth, Babies
Storytimes
Waitlist
Registration Required
Library Branch: Villa Park Public Library
Room: Jelf Room (Youth Services Program Room)
Age Group: Youth, Babies
Program Type: Storytimes
Registration Required
Event Details:

Sign up for either Tuesdays -OR- Thursdays • 9:30-10 am

This event is in the "Youth" group
This event is in the "Babies" group
This event is in the "Toddlers" group
This event is in the "Preschool" group
This event is in the "Family" group

Family Playdate

10:30am–12:00pm
Youth, Babies, Toddlers, Preschool, Family
Library Branch: Villa Park Public Library
Room: Ohrman Room A/B
Age Group: Youth, Babies, Toddlers, Preschool, Family
Event Details:

Ages 5 & under with adult

Tuesday, Apr. 21 • 10:30am-12pm

This event is in the "Youth" group
This event is in the "Babies" group
This event is in the "Toddlers" group
This event is in the "Preschool" group
This event is in the "Kindergarten" group
This event is in the "Family" group

Family Pajama Storytime

6:30pm–7:00pm
Youth, Babies, Toddlers, Preschool, Kindergarten, Family
Storytimes
Waitlist
Registration Required
Library Branch: Villa Park Public Library
Room: Jelf Room (Youth Services Program Room)
Age Group: Youth, Babies, Toddlers, Preschool, Kindergarten, Family
Program Type: Storytimes
Registration Required
Event Details:

Pajamas are optional, but very welcome at this program! We’ll share stories, music, and gentle movement for families with young children of all ages. Register for one or more dates.

This event is in the "Adults" group

Nothing But the Facts: Buzz by Thor Hanson

7:00pm–8:15pm
Adults
Book Discussions
Open
Registration Required
Library Branch: Villa Park Public Library
Room: Board Room
Age Group: Adults
Program Type: Book Discussions
Registration Required
Library Branch: Villa Park Public Library
Room: Ohrman Room A/B
This event is in the "Youth" group
This event is in the "Preschool" group

Preschool Storytime

10:00am–10:30am
Youth, Preschool
Storytimes
Waitlist
Registration Required
Library Branch: Villa Park Public Library
Room: Jelf Room (Youth Services Program Room)
Age Group: Youth, Preschool
Program Type: Storytimes
Registration Required
Event Details:

This lively program of imaginative stories, learning games, and musical fun is designed for 3-5 year olds to attend on their own.

This is a SERIES program.

This event is in the "Adults" group
This event is in the "Seniors" group

Mindful Movement

10:00am–11:00am
Adults, Seniors
Health & Wellness
Open
Registration Required
Library Branch: Villa Park Public Library
Room: Ohrman Room A/B
Age Group: Adults, Seniors
Program Type: Health & Wellness
Registration Required
Event Details:

Join us for a one-hour mindful movement class where you’re encouraged to explore your body’s natural rhythm and flow.

This event is in the "Youth" group
This event is in the "Preschool" group
This event is in the "Kindergarten" group

Ready for Reading

1:15pm–2:00pm
Youth, Preschool, Kindergarten
Storytimes
Waitlist
Registration Required
Library Branch: Villa Park Public Library
Room: Jelf Room (Youth Services Program Room)
Age Group: Youth, Preschool, Kindergarten
Program Type: Storytimes
Registration Required
Event Details:

Using stories, musical games and word play, children are introduced to letter friends from A to Z.

For ages 4 and older.

This is a SERIES program.

This event is in the "Youth" group
This event is in the "Elementary School" group

Pokémon Club

3:30pm–4:30pm
Youth, Elementary School
S.T.E.A.M. Programs
Waitlist
Registration Required
Library Branch: Villa Park Public Library
Room: Jelf Room (Youth Services Program Room)
Age Group: Youth, Elementary School
Program Type: S.T.E.A.M. Programs
Registration Required
Event Details:

The library is partnering with Pokémon and the American Library Association (ALA) to present a new program for youth: Pokémon Club! Spark creativity through games and reading activities as kids can play, engage, learn, grow, and connect!

Library Board Meeting

7:00pm–9:00pm
Library Branch: Villa Park Public Library
Room: Board Room
This event is in the "Youth" group
This event is in the "Babies" group

Babies & Books - Thursdays

9:30am–10:00am
Youth, Babies
Storytimes
Waitlist
Registration Required
Library Branch: Villa Park Public Library
Room: Jelf Room (Youth Services Program Room)
Age Group: Youth, Babies
Program Type: Storytimes
Registration Required
Event Details:

Sign up for either Tuesdays -OR- Thursdays • 9:30-10 am

This event is in the "Youth" group
This event is in the "Toddlers" group

Toddler Time - Thursdays 10:30am

10:30am–11:00am
Youth, Toddlers
Storytimes
Waitlist
Registration Required
Library Branch: Villa Park Public Library
Room: Jelf Room (Youth Services Program Room)
Age Group: Youth, Toddlers
Program Type: Storytimes
Registration Required
Event Details:

Sign up for ONE weekly session time:

  • Mondays 10:30-11am -OR-
  • Mondays 11:30am-12pm -OR-
  • Thursdays 10:30-11am
  • Thursdays
This event is in the "Youth" group
This event is in the "Toddlers" group

Toddler Time - Thursdays 11:30am

11:30am–12:00pm
Youth, Toddlers
Storytimes
Waitlist
Registration Required
Library Branch: Villa Park Public Library
Room: Jelf Room (Youth Services Program Room)
Age Group: Youth, Toddlers
Program Type: Storytimes
Registration Required
Event Details:

Sign up for ONE weekly session time:

  • Mondays 10:30-11am -OR-
  • Mondays 11:30am-12pm -OR-
  • Thursdays 10:30-11am
  • Thursdays